Müßiggang - Seite 10

 
Hallo zusammen. Ich dachte, dass ich selbst nicht von der Gier erstickt werden würde, bis der Dienst in Ordnung ist, werde ich die Agenten entfernen, was mit ihnen. Es scheint, dass sie nicht stören, aber wenn man anfängt, sich damit zu beschäftigen, merkt man, dass jemand die Ressourcen meines Computers verschwendet. Aber ich werde auf jeden Fall beobachten, wie es weitergeht, die Idee ist interessant, aber noch nicht ganz fertig.
 

Die Mäuse stachen und schrien, aber sie fraßen weiter den Kaktus.

:))

 

2863

Bis jetzt hat sich nichts geändert: um16:06:34.463 haben wir die Aufgabe bekommen, wir waren bis16:16:13.313 im Leerlauf. Was ein Agent (oder vielmehr drei Agenten) zehn Minuten lang gemacht hat, bleibt ein Rätsel. Es gibt keine Informationen über die in diesen zehn Minuten geleistete Arbeit. Und wieder gibt es keinen elementaren Logfile-Dump des Agentenstatus (Prozentsatz der erledigten Arbeit).

QP      0       16:01:28.144    Network authorized on agent3.mql5.net for barabashkakvn
PJ      0       16:06:34.463    Network 4372 bytes of account info loaded
MQ      0       16:06:34.463    Network 1470 bytes of tester parameters loaded
RE      0       16:06:34.463    Network 42684 bytes of input parameters loaded
PP      0       16:06:34.463    Network 1138 bytes of symbols list loaded (165 symbols)
JD      0       16:06:34.463    Tester  job 6945803875387462663 received from Cloud Server
RG      0       16:06:34.463    Tester  file added, 256322 bytes loaded
IO      0       16:06:34.463    Network 55812 bytes of optimized inputs info loaded
IE      0       16:06:34.566    Tester  successfully initialized
KH      0       16:06:34.566    Network 378 Kb of total initialization data received
MK      0       16:06:34.566    Tester  Intel Core i7-9750 H  @ 2.60 GHz, 32574 MB
PL      0       16:06:34.566    Tester  optimization pass 89 started
GL      0       16:06:34.575    Symbols GER30: symbol to be synchronized
DH      0       16:06:34.596    Symbols GER30: symbol synchronized, 3720 bytes of symbol info received
HD      0       16:06:35.780    History GER30: load 25 bytes of history data to synchronize in 0:00:00.035
FQ      0       16:06:35.780    History GER30: history synchronized from 2019.01.02 to 2021.03.30
RS      0       16:06:35.861    History GER30,M15: history cache allocated for 50292 bars and contains 19020 bars from 2019.01.02 09:00 to 2019.12.30 22:45
CR      0       16:06:35.861    History GER30,M15: history begins from 2019.01.02 09:00
EK      0       16:06:36.800    History GER30,M1: history cache allocated for 752845 bars and contains 283773 bars from 2019.01.02 09:00 to 2019.12.30 22:59
HJ      0       16:06:36.801    History GER30,M1: history begins from 2019.01.02 09:00
IP      0       16:16:13.313    Tester  tester agent shutdown started
JF      0       16:16:13.313    Tester  shutdown tester machine
GR      0       16:16:13.595    Tester  tester process stopped
GJ      0       16:16:13.596    Tester  tester agent shutdown finished
 

Die Situation wiederholt sich - die Agenten zappeln eine Stunde lang herum und nichts wird in die Protokolldatei geschrieben. Der letzte Eintrag erfolgte um 12:46:02.921 Uhr. Musste Agenten um13:47:50.660 töten

RD      0       12:35:50.087    Tester  optimization pass 12884902275 (3, 387) started
LP      0       12:35:50.097    Symbols EURUSD: symbol to be synchronized
PK      0       12:35:50.177    Symbols EURUSD: symbol synchronized, 3720 bytes of symbol info received
RR      0       12:45:49.677    History EURUSD: load 27 bytes of history data to synchronize in 0:09:59.490
PL      0       12:45:49.677    History EURUSD: history synchronized from 1999.01.04 to 2021.05.14
LE      0       12:45:49.762    History EURUSD,M1: history cache allocated for 8321790 bars and contains 294777 bars from 1999.01.04 10:22 to 1999.12.31 23:01
NG      0       12:45:49.762    History EURUSD,M1: history begins from 1999.01.04 10:22
FR      0       12:46:02.691    History EURUSD,H1: history cache allocated for 139958 bars and contains 6175 bars from 1999.01.04 10:00 to 1999.12.31 23:00
RK      0       12:46:02.691    History EURUSD,H1: history begins from 1999.01.04 10:00
OL      0       12:46:02.748    History EURUSD,H6: history cache allocated for 23336 bars and contains 1039 bars from 1999.01.04 06:00 to 1999.12.31 18:00
HS      0       12:46:02.749    History EURUSD,H6: history begins from 1999.01.04 06:00
QK      0       12:46:02.799    History EURUSD,H4: history cache allocated for 35004 bars and contains 1558 bars from 1999.01.04 08:00 to 1999.12.31 20:00
RH      0       12:46:02.800    History EURUSD,H4: history begins from 1999.01.04 08:00
JE      0       12:46:02.857    History EURUSD,M6: history cache allocated for 1396942 bars and contains 59107 bars from 1999.01.04 10:18 to 1999.12.31 23:00
FE      0       12:46:02.857    History EURUSD,M6: history begins from 1999.01.04 10:18
LR      0       12:46:02.921    History EURUSD,M3: history cache allocated for 2788497 bars and contains 112826 bars from 1999.01.04 10:21 to 1999.12.31 23:00
FL      0       12:46:02.921    History EURUSD,M3: history begins from 1999.01.04 10:21
GJ      0       13:47:50.660    Startup service shutdown initialized
RQ      0       13:47:50.660    Exit    shutdown thread started
PJ      0       13:47:50.716    Server  MetaTester 5 stopped

Wie Sie sehen können, gibt es zwischen 12:46:02.921 und13:47:50.660 überhaupt keine Meldungen.

Bitte: Ist es möglich, Service-Informationen anzuzeigen, z.B. alle drei Minuten - Auftragsnummer so und so, der Prozess läuft weiter?


Ich werde alle Agenten für eine Woche löschen, vielleicht ändert sich während dieser Woche etwas.

 

Die Agenten arbeiteten gestern etwas mehr als eine Stunde lang. Das Ergebnis war ein wenig unerwartet:


Ich füge das Archiv der vier Agenten für den 13.01.2022 bei.

Dateien:
13.01.2022.zip  76 kb
 

Die Agenten arbeiteten eine Stunde lang

wurde

Bei PR 163 betrug die Zahlung 0,05 $.

Was ist passiert? Haben sie die Gebühren für die Agenten gesenkt? Dieser Betrag ist drei- bis viermal niedriger als üblich. Oder arbeiten einige Bedienstete immer noch im Schleifenmodus, aber kostenlos?


Ich füge die Protokolle für den 17. an.

Dateien:
Tester.zip  119 kb
 
Ich habe es deinstalliert, weil es überhaupt nichts gebracht hat und der Computer manchmal die CPU auf 100 % auslastet, was langsam nervig wurde. Ich denke, es ist einfacher, das Mining auf der Grafikkarte zu aktivieren, als die Agenten zu behalten...... Es ist wie folgt
 

Die Agenten erhielten ihre Aufträge. Sie haben etwa 25 bis 30 Minuten lang geredet. Aber der Zähler hat sich nicht verändert.

Das ist die Aufgabe (aus dem Protokoll eines Agenten). Verlauf, Symbol, Ticks wurden synchronisiert, aber nichts ging in den Auftrag ein.

Ist es möglich, einen detaillierteren Kommentar über das Schicksal des Auftrags in das Protokoll zu schreiben: zum Beispiel, ob der Auftrag auf der Client-Seite gestoppt wurde oder ob der Auftrag auf meiner Seite unterbrochen wurde ... ?

GN      0       10:19:02.373    History XAUUSD,M5: history begins from 2021.01.04 01:00
FI      0       10:19:02.529    Tester  job 7058008938217744221 received from Cloud Server
NM      0       10:19:02.529    Tester  file added, 8987 bytes loaded
JJ      0       10:19:02.624    History XAUUSD,M30: history cache allocated for 12705 bars and contains 11809 bars from 2021.01.04 01:00 to 2021.12.31 20:30
HI      0       10:19:02.624    History XAUUSD,M30: history begins from 2021.01.04 01:00
PQ      0       10:19:02.700    History XAUUSD,M10: history cache allocated for 38109 bars and contains 35422 bars from 2021.01.04 01:00 to 2021.12.31 20:50
KF      0       10:19:02.700    History XAUUSD,M10: history begins from 2021.01.04 01:00
JN      0       10:19:02.779    History XAUUSD,H2: history cache allocated for 3307 bars and contains 3083 bars from 2021.01.04 00:00 to 2021.12.31 20:00
JP      0       10:19:02.779    History XAUUSD,H2: history begins from 2021.01.04 00:00
NH      0       10:19:11.826    Symbols EURUSD: symbol to be synchronized
NO      0       10:19:11.928    Symbols EURUSD: symbol synchronized, 3720 bytes of symbol info received
QO      0       10:19:12.372    History EURUSD: load 12 Kb of history data to synchronize in 0:00:00.077
LD      0       10:19:12.372    History EURUSD: history synchronized from 2017.01.02 to 2022.01.27
CL      0       10:19:12.376    Ticks   EURUSD: ticks synchronization started
OE      0       10:19:12.689    Ticks   EURUSD: load 712 Kb of tick data to synchronize in 0:00:00.313
JF      0       10:19:12.689    Ticks   EURUSD: history ticks synchronized from 2013.04.01 to 2022.01.26
JS      0       10:19:12.711    Symbols XAUEUR: symbol to be synchronized
JG      0       10:19:12.792    Symbols XAUEUR: symbol synchronized, 3720 bytes of symbol info received
CG      0       10:19:13.260    History XAUEUR: load 2.26 Mb of history data to synchronize in 0:00:00.466
LL      0       10:19:13.260    History XAUEUR: history synchronized from 2021.01.04 to 2022.01.27
RD      0       10:19:13.260    Ticks   XAUEUR: ticks synchronization started
FM      0       10:19:14.862    Ticks   XAUEUR: load 10.03 Mb of tick data to synchronize in 0:00:01.594
JN      0       10:19:14.862    Ticks   XAUEUR: history ticks synchronized from 2022.01.03 to 2022.01.26
CE      0       10:57:59.709    Tester  tester agent shutdown started
PQ      0       10:57:59.709    Tester  shutdown tester machine
HI      0       10:57:59.720    Tester  tester process stopped
FO      0       10:57:59.721    Tester  tester agent shutdown finished
DL      0       10:57:59.721            rescan needed
OI      0       10:58:04.559    Network connected to agent1.mql5.net
EN      0       10:58:05.948    Network connected to agent2.mql5.net
 

Ich grüße Sie alle. Ich habe die gleiche Situation. 16 Kerne haben zwei Stunden lang gehämmert, und damit ist ein Auftrag erledigt. Kurzum, ich habe 4 Kerne zum Vergleich übrig gelassen.

Nun, zumindest haben die Entwickler eine Erklärung dafür geliefert. Ich denke, dass das ganze Problem im Speicher liegt. Je mehr Speicherplatz Sie haben, desto mehr Aufgaben werden Ihnen gestellt. Und weniger Chancen auf Arbeit.

Es gibt auch die Annahme, dass die gleiche Aufgabe an viele Agenten, die Zeit hatte erste und geschlossen.

Aber das ist meine Vermutung.

Wie macht man Aufgaben dünner? Wir müssen den Speicher pro Thread begrenzen.

Der Basisordner enthält beispielsweise eine Reihe von heruntergeladenen Geschichten für die Synchronisierung, die möglicherweise nie wieder verwendet werden.

Ich warte auf eine Erklärung. Ich habe versehentlich denselben Thread eröffnet. Wir müssen sie schließen und hier diskutieren.

 
Vladimir Karputov #:

Die Agenten erhielten ihre Aufträge. Sie haben etwa 25 bis 30 Minuten lang geredet. Aber der Zähler hat sich nicht verändert.

Das ist die Aufgabe (aus dem Protokoll eines Agenten). Verlauf, Symbol, Ticks wurden synchronisiert, aber nichts ging in den Auftrag ein.

Ist es möglich, einen detaillierteren Kommentar über das Schicksal des Auftrags in das Protokoll zu schreiben: zum Beispiel, ob der Auftrag auf der Client-Seite gestoppt wurde oder ob der Auftrag auf meiner Seite unterbrochen wurde ... ?

Vielleicht würde es helfen. Ich habe das Programm abgeschaltet. Das Verzeichnis und alles, was damit verbunden ist, wurde gelöscht. Bereinigung der Registrierung und aller Verweise auf das Wort tester. Installieren Sie die Agenten neu. Ich habe langsam wieder angefangen, herumzustöbern.